Summary:

The 74743 zip code area is home to two middle schools - Hugo Middle School and Rattan Junior High School. While both schools face challenges, Rattan Junior High stands out with a significantly lower student-teacher ratio and stronger mathematics performance compared to the state average.

Rattan Junior High School has a student-teacher ratio of 9.4, much lower than Hugo Middle School's 29.0, suggesting more personalized attention for students. Rattan Junior High also excels in 8th grade mathematics, with 52% of students proficient or better, well above the state average of 25%. However, both schools struggle with low proficiency rates in English Language Arts, falling behind the state average across all grades.

While Rattan Junior High performs better academically, Hugo Middle School serves a higher percentage of economically disadvantaged students, with 87.76% receiving free or reduced-price lunch, compared to 76.36% at Rattan Junior High. Both schools have concerning chronic absenteeism rates of 19.0%, indicating a need for improved student engagement. Overall, the data highlights the complexities faced by these middle schools and the importance of targeted interventions to support student success.
